Bravely Default 2 is a JRPG sequel set to pull players into a sprawling adventure with charming characters, deadly monsters and plenty of creative surprises.

First Impressions

I’m enjoying my time with Bravely Default 2, even if a few notable issues hold it back from being a true JRPG great. However, such issues don’t detract from a thoroughly engaging core experience, which builds upon the original game in delightful ways.
